Re: [Rhythmbox-devel] [BUILD FAILURE] In rb-playlist-source.c related tototem_pl_parser_write_with_title ()



Il giorno mer, 11/01/2006 alle 21.30 +1100, James Livingston ha scritto:
> On Wed, 2006-01-11 at 10:48 +0100, Luca Ferretti wrote:
> > rb-playlist-source.c: In function 'rb_playlist_source_save_playlist':
> > rb-playlist-source.c:483: warning: passing argument 3 of
> > 'totem_pl_parser_write_with_title' from incompatible pointer type
> > make[2]: *** [rb-playlist-source.lo] Error 1
> > make[2]: Leaving directory `/test/cvs/gnome2/rhythmbox/sources'
> > make[1]: *** [all-recursive] Error 1
> > make[1]: Leaving directory `/test/cvs/gnome2/rhythmbox'
> > make: *** [all] Error 2
> 
> Can you see if changing "playlist_iter_func" to
> "(TotemPlParserIterFunc)playlist_iter_func" on that line helps? If so,
> I'll fix it in cvs.
> 

OK, it compiles and link and run, BUT testing I found:

     1. RB crash on startup if dbus-session is not running (see attached
        traceback)
     2. RB fails (corrupted playlist or unknown format) to load a simple
        test playlist saved with Totem using .pl (Perl files) as
        extension. The same playlist, renamed as test.playlist can be
        successfully imported in RB.
Backtrace was generated from '/opt/gnome2/bin/rhythmbox'

Using host libthread_db library "/lib/tls/i686/cmov/libthread_db.so.1".
`system-supplied DSO at 0xffffe000' has disappeared; keeping its symbols.
[Thread debugging using libthread_db enabled]
[New Thread -1229203776 (LWP 5686)]
0xffffe410 in __kernel_vsyscall ()
#0  0xffffe410 in __kernel_vsyscall ()
#1  0xb7677483 in __waitpid_nocancel ()
   from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b7ef207b in libgnomeui_segv_handle (signum=5) at gnome-ui-init.c:792
#3  <signal handler called>
#4  IA__g_logv (log_domain=) at gmessages.c:503
#5  0xb6d4ffce in IA__g_log (log_domain=0x80f9078 "Rhythmbox", 
    log_level=G_LOG_LEVEL_CRITICAL, 
    format=0x80e9d6c "couldn't connect to session bus: %s") at gmessages.c:517
#6  0x0806a270 in main (argc=1, argv=0xbf9616c4) at main.c:255

Thread 1 (Thread -1229203776 (LWP 5686)):
#0  0xffffe410 in __kernel_vsyscall ()
No symbol table info available.
#1  0xb7677483 in __waitpid_nocancel ()
   from /lib/tls/i686/cmov/libpthread.so.0
No symbol table info available.
#2  0xb7ef207b in libgnomeui_segv_handle (signum=5) at gnome-ui-init.c:792
	estatus = 0
	in_segv = 1
	sa = {__sigaction_handler = {sa_handler = 0, sa_sigaction = 0}, 
  sa_mask = {__val = {3066115854, 3214281264, 4294967295, 3067216424, 
      3066083264, 3067218296, 143360, 136265760, 135433680, 3214281760, 
      3067218232, 3067218176, 40, 3067218176, 3214281456, 3067159855, 
      136261664, 4294963200, 3067218232, 3067218176, 2, 3214271888, 
      3214271960, 0, 4095, 3214281760, 0, 136290304, 24264, 136266040, 
      3067218176, 0}}, sa_flags = -1227755300, sa_restorer = 0x100}
	pid = #0  0xffffe410 in __kernel_vsyscall ()


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]